This is my local shop. John and Harry have owned the place for 20plus years. IMO Katsu has the best local vibe of any coffeeshop in Amsterdam. The local scene is very cool and all the regs have their own stories. One of the nicest things about the Katsu is that they treat visitors like locals. Everyone feels at home at Katsu. There is now a bench out front(because of the new smoking laws) and rumor has it that a awning(overhang) will be added for the smokers when it rains. Katsu has terrace rights in front of the shop but have never done much with it. That will change next summer. Sitting out front of Katsu is one of my favorite ways to spend a couple hours. It is a great people watching place.
